Тип | |
---|---|
Написана на |
Python и другие |
Операционная система | |
Аппаратная платформа | |
Состояние |
Активный |
Лицензия | |
Сайт |
openembedded.org |
OpenEmbedded — инфраструктура для сборки пакетов для встраиваемого Linux. OpenEmbedded предлагает лучшее решение в классе сред для кросс-компиляции. Он позволяет разработчикам создавать целостные дистрибутивы Linux для встраиваемых систем.
Некоторыми преимуществами OpenEmbedded являются:
Изначально проект содержал и разрабатывал набор рецептов для BitBake, схожих с правилами ebuild для Gentoo.
Рецепты состоят из URL на исходный код пакета, зависимостей сборки и установки и опций компилирования и установки. Во время процесса сборки они используются для отслеживания зависимостей, кросс-компилирования пакета и его запаковывания, годного для установки на целевое устройство. Также возможно создавать полные образы, состоящие из корневой файловой системы и ядра. На первом шаге при сборке компилируется кросс-тулчейн для целевой платформы.
Это заготовка статьи о Linux. Вы можете помочь проекту, исправив и дополнив её. |
OpenEmbedded.